Essential Ingredients You’ll Need

To create these mouthwatering lemon ricotta pancakes, you’ll need a few key ingredients: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our: This provides the foundation for the pancakes, giving them structure and substance.
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der: A crucial ingredient that helps the pancakes rise and achieve their fluffy texture.
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t: A simple seasoning that enhances the other flavors.
  • 1 cup whole milk ricotta cheese: The star of the show, adding that signature creamy richness.
  • 2 large eggs: Binding the ingredients together and contributing to the pancakes’ light and tender crumb.
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ar: Providing a gentle sweetness that balances the tart lemon.
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est: Infusing the pancakes with a bright, citrusy aroma and flavor.
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ice: Brightening the overall taste and adding a tangy note.
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ted: Enriching the batter and adding a luxurious mouthfeel.

Step-by-Step Lemon Ricotta Pancakes Instructions

Preparing Your Lemon Ricotta Pancakes

With a total prep and cook time of just 30 minutes, these lemon ricotta pancakes are the perfect breakfast or brunch option. You’ll need a large mixing bowl, a whisk, and a nonstick skillet or griddle to get started.

1-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t until well combined.
2- In a separate bowl, beat the ricotta cheese, eggs, granulated sugar, lemon zest, and lemon juice until smooth and creamy.
3- Gently fold the wet ricotta mixture into the dry ingredients, being careful not to overmix. The batter should have a few lumps – this will ensure your pancakes are light and airy.
4- Heat a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ium heat and brush it with the melted butter. Scoop about 1/4 cup of batter per pancake onto the hot surface, making sure to leave enough space between each one.
5- Cook the pancakes for 2-3 minutes per side, or until golden brown and cooked through. Adjust the heat as needed to prevent burning.
6- Serve the lemon ricotta pancakes warm, topped with a drizzle of maple syrup, a sprinkle of powdered sugar, or your favorite fresh fruit. Enjoy this delightful breakfast treat!

Pro Tips for Success

  1. Don’t overmix the batter: Gently folding the ingredients together will prevent the pancakes from becoming tough and dense.
  2. Adjust the heat as you cook: Keep an eye on the pancakes and adjust the heat as needed to ensure even browning.
  3. Resist the urge to press down on the pancakes: This can lead to a dense, heavy texture. Let them cook and rise naturally.
  4. Measure the ingredients carefully: Precise measurements will ensure your lemon ricotta pancakes turn out perfectly every time.
  5. Zest the lemon before juicing: This will give you the maximum amount of bright, citrusy flavor.

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ips

Lemon ricotta pancakes are best enjoyed fresh, but you can definitely make them ahead of time. To store leftovers, let the pancakes cool completely, then place them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. When ready to reheat, simply pop them in the toaster or oven at 350°F until warmed through.

For longer-term storage, you can also freeze the lemon ricotta pancakes.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container. They’ll keep in the freezer for up to 2 months. To reheat, simply place the frozen pancakes in the oven at 350°F for 10-15 minutes, or until heated through.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I use low-fat or non-fat ricotta cheese instead of whole milk ricotta?
A: While you can use low-fat or non-fat ricotta, the whole milk version will provide the best texture and richness for these lemon ricotta pancakes. The higher fat content helps create a luxurious, creamy result.

Q: How long does it take to make these lemon ricotta pancakes?
A: The total time to prepare and cook these lemon ricotta pancakes is just 30 minutes. The prep time is 15 minutes, and the cook time is another 15 minutes.

Q: Can I make the batter ahead of time?
A: Yes, you can make the lemon ricotta pancake batter up to 24 hours in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Just be sure to give it a quick stir before cooking to incorporate any settled ingredients.

Q: How many pancakes does this recipe make?
A: This lemon ricotta pancake recipe yields 12 servings, so you’ll have plenty to share (or enjoy all to yourself!).

Q: What if my pancakes aren’t cooking evenly?
A: If you notice some areas of the pancakes cooking faster than others, adjust the heat on your skillet or griddle. A moderate, even heat is key for perfectly cooked lemon ricotta pancakes.

Notes

For fluffier pancakes, separate the egg whites and whip them to soft peaks before folding into the batter. You can also experiment with different types of citrus zest, such as orange or grapefruit, for a twist on the classic flavor.
